What does the term "ram recovery" refer to in aviation?

  1. Improving control at low speeds

  2. Increasing pressure and airflow at high speeds

  3. Reducing fuel consumption

  4. Enhancing overall engine performance

The correct answer is: Increasing pressure and airflow at high speeds

The term "ram recovery" in aviation specifically refers to the phenomenon where the speed of the aircraft increases the pressure and airflow into the engine's intake. This is particularly noteworthy at high speeds, where the kinetic energy of the moving air can be harnessed to improve engine performance. Essentially, as the aircraft moves forward, it forces more air into the engine, which helps to boost the pressure and improves the efficiency of the combustion process. This principle is vital in turbojet and turbofan engines, where maximizing airflow into the engine at high speeds can lead to better thrust output. Ram recovery helps in achieving more powerful engine operation without a corresponding increase in fuel consumption, although that is not its primary focus.
